Indexer property value reader

This value reader returns the value from the specified indexer property.
An example of an indexer property is a key on a dictionary. This value reader can be used to read a specific entry from a dictionary.
| Expected source object type | Any type of object as long as it has an indexer property. |
|---|---|
| Template location | Data Exchange/Framework/Data Access/Value Readers/Indexer Property Value Reader |
Template fields
Template fields
| Field name | Description |
|---|---|
| Indexes | The index used to read a value from the source object. Multiple index values can be separated by either a comma (,) or semicolon (;). |
